Why Businesses Are Migrating to the Cloud
The benefits of cloud adoption are compelling. Instead of investing heavily in hardware that quickly becomes obsolete, companies can pay only for the resources they use. This flexibility is particularly valuable for seasonal businesses common in the Sefton coastal region, where demand can fluctuate dramatically throughout the year.
Cloud platforms also enhance collaboration, enabling teams to access files and applications from anywhere, an advantage that became essential with the rise of remote and hybrid working. Automatic backups, robust security, and rapid recovery capabilities further reduce risk, giving business owners peace of mind that their data is protected against hardware failure or cyber threats.

Key Services to Expect
A comprehensive cloud provider should offer infrastructure as a service, platform as a service, and software as a service options, along with expert guidance on which model suits your needs. Migration planning is critical, as poorly executed transitions can cause downtime and data loss. The best providers conduct thorough audits before recommending a strategy.
Managed security is another cornerstone. This includes firewalls, intrusion detection, encryption, and continuous monitoring. Providers should also deliver clear service level agreements, guaranteeing uptime and defining response times so that clients know exactly what to expect.
Trends Driving Cloud Adoption
Several developments are shaping the cloud market in Sefton. Multi-cloud strategies, where businesses use more than one provider, are becoming popular as organisations seek to avoid vendor lock-in and improve resilience. Edge computing is also emerging, bringing processing closer to users for faster performance.
Sustainability is an increasingly important consideration. Many providers now emphasise energy-efficient data centres and carbon-conscious practices, appealing to Sefton businesses that want to reduce their environmental footprint. Meanwhile, the integration of artificial intelligence into cloud platforms is unlocking powerful new capabilities for automation and analytics.
Choosing the Right Provider
Selecting a cloud partner requires careful evaluation. Consider the provider's technical certifications, track record, and familiarity with your industry. Ask about security protocols, data sovereignty, and how they handle compliance with regulations relevant to your sector.
Support quality is paramount. Cloud systems underpin critical operations, so responsive, knowledgeable support can make an enormous difference during an outage or emergency. Local providers in Sefton often shine here, offering personal service and a genuine commitment to their clients' success.
